Our Lady of Lourdes Hospital in Drogheda is recruiting a Registered Advanced Nurse Practitioner (RANP) to join its Sexual Health Service. This is a permanent, wholetime post at Advanced Nurse Practitioner (General) grade, offering a highly experienced nurse the opportunity to work at the forefront of specialist ambulatory sexual health care in the HSE Dublin and North East region.
About the Role
The Sexual Health Service at Our Lady of Lourdes Hospital provides specialist ambulatory care in line with the National Sexual Health Strategy. The service operates across two sites — Our Lady of Lourdes Hospital, Drogheda and Louth County Hospital, Dundalk — and is governed by three consultants (one GUM and two Infectious Diseases). In addition to outpatient ambulatory care, the service delivers a consultant-led consult service for inpatients across both settings.
The Registered Advanced Nurse Practitioner will practise autonomously within a defined scope of practice, delivering evidence-based, patient-centred care to individuals attending the sexual health service across outpatient and inpatient settings.
